Enyobeni tavern owner Siyakhangela Ndevu has admitted that it was his responsibility to ensure that there were no under aged children at his tavern, when 21 teenagers died in June 2022.
Ndevu was testifying at the inquest under way at the East London Magistrate’s Court sitting in Mdantsane in the Eastern Cape.
The Inquest seeks to establish if anyone could be held accountable for the death of the children at the tavern based in Scenery Park in East London.

Ndevu said he was at the initiation school to attend to an emergency involving his son when he received a call from one of his employees informing him about the patrons who were forcing their entry into the establishment.
“Whose’ duty is it to ensure that there are no underaged? It’s my responsibility but I will not take control of everything I would delegate other people to other places to see to it there are no loopholes.”
